The 4-inch Soil Temperature map displays the current soil temperature (degrees F) at 4 inches (10 cm) under the existing vegetative cover at each Mesonet site. In the Layers tab of the sidebar, use the pull-down menus to select your options: Set the calendar to the desired Date (data from today become available in two business days) Select the desired Observation (temperature, precipitation, snowfall ...The Regional Mesonet Program (RMP) produces Soil Temperature maps at 2-inch and 4-inch depth for both bare soil and sod for the Midwest region. Begun in 2013, the RMP piloted this mosaic-style concept with soil temperature data from around the region. Weather Data Library Kansas Mesonet Kansas State University 1004 Throckmorton Manhattan, KS 66506 785-532-7019 or 785-532-3029 Feb 21, 2017 · A soil media temperature of 60 to 68 degrees will encourage germination. Watch the media temperature carefully, as seed can enter a thermal dormancy if germination temperatures are excessive. Also, a cooler temperature of 55 to 60 degrees should be used once the plants emerge. Time to maturity varies depending on the type of lettuce, with leaf ...

student homes The Kansas Mesonet Secondary Network provides soil temperature data for agricultural purposes. Users can access maps, graphs, and tables of soil temperature at various depths and locations across the state. For the week of April 4-10, average weekly soil temperatures at 2 inches among crop reporting districts ranged from 42 o F (northern locations) to 60 o F (southern locations) (Figure 1).
